Methods and systems for authentication for high-risk communications

1. A method for authenticating interactions, the method comprising:
receiving a request to approve an interaction initiated by a first device associated with a user;
causing a notification to be displayed by the first device to prompt an authentication interaction between a second device associated with the user and a remote authentication system;
monitoring interaction data from an interaction network for authentication interaction information generated from the prompted authentication interaction;
identifying, from the monitored interaction data, the authentication interaction information, the authentication interaction information including a coded sequence generated by the remote authentication system based at least in part on the second device;
determining the coded sequence in the authentication interaction information matches an expected coded sequence, the match indicating the second device is authentic; and
approving the interaction based on the determined match.
